Stacking Features
HP Procurve Stack Management (termed stacking) enables you to use a single
IP address and standard network cabling to manage a group of up to 16 total
switches in the same IP subnet (broadcast domain). Using stacking, you can:
Reduce the number of IP addresses needed in your network.
